Project GAWIS: Gift-giving, Adversity Quotient Enhancement and Ways of Integrating Spirituality to Learners

Project GAWIS came from the Kankana-ey term “gawis” which means good and its operational defined as Gift-giving, Adversity Quotient Enhancement and Ways of Integrating Spirituality to Learners. This project was conducted as a way for the school to share love during this time of pandemic and as a way of expressing to learners that there are people who care about them and that they’re important to this world. Further, it was an integral part of our life to be resilient in life challenges and not to lose faith to God.

Objectives:

At the end of the project, the 50 underprivileged learners:

a. received personal hygiene kits and food packs;

b. increased adversity quotient level and enhanced spiritual aspects; and

c. increased academic performance from below 75 to 80 percent and above percent
